Site Reliability Engineer (Private Cloud / Virtualization) Cisco is transforming its platforms to run the next generation of cloud-native and multi-cloud services. This role offers a superb opportunity to transform how infrastructure platforms are developed and managed with full software automation. This team is responsible for building, deploying and managing a large enterprise grade private cloud infrastructure within Cisco data center, which caters to Ciscos Business Critical applications available both internally and externally. The platform provides a very close public cloud experience to Cisco employees and at the same time is highly available with self-healing, full lifecycle monitoring, and management capabilities. Who you will work with You will be working within the Cloud Infrastructure Engineering team that designs and develops Hybrid-Cloud compute platforms and capabilities that are crucial to keeping Cisco's critical business applications and processes available. What youll Do You will be a member of a software & site reliability engineering team that develops tools and integrations for a portfolio of cloud infrastructure services supporting Ciscos critical business operations. As a SRE (Private Cloud / Virtualization) with extensive experience in enterprise-level private cloud setups, you will join a dynamic and agile team of talented engineers focused on developing and deploying platform automation and tools for on-premises (OpenStack/BareMetal) cloud infrastructure. Proven experience with KVM, virtualization, Python, Ansible & AI skills is essential for this role. Responsibilities: The individual will develop and deliver software to enhance the functionality, reliability, availability, and manageability of applications and cloud platforms using a DevOps model for on-premise solution built on Bare Metal Servers or on OpenStack. They will ensure the quality, performance, robustness, and scalability of services, automate development processes through CI/CD pipelines, and champion Infrastructure as Code (IaaC) practices. Additionally, they will apply global IT infrastructure knowledge to develop standard solutions, evaluate new technologies, and engage cross-functional teams to solve problems or add business value. The role also includes setting and measuring SLOs for infrastructure, creating monitoring and logging features, and influencing technology decisions and policies. Required Skills and Experience: 8+ years of IT experience; 5+ years of relevant experience in Virtualization and Cloud Infrastructure. Solid cloud infrastructure background and operational, fixing , problem-solving experience especially in RHEL KVM environments. Software development lifecycle including design, development, testing, packaging, deployment, upgrade and support. Extensive experience in RHEL KVM virtualization, including configuring and optimizing virtual machines, networking, and high availability. Experience with Red Hat Enterprise Linux and/or CentOS build, development, and operations. Strong software development experience in Python, with proven experience in Ansible for configuration management. OpenStack operations experience; a bility to write patches for OpenStack in python and contribute to community. Experience with software-defined storage with Ceph or other cloud-based storage. Hypervisor technologies including KVM Experience in building and maintaining code distribution through automated pipelines Software-defined network technologies including OVS, OVN, NFV, etc. IaaC experience Terraform, Ansible, Git, GitLab, GitHub, Jenkins, Helm, ArgoCD, Conjur/Vault Experience in deploying and managing (IaaS) infrastructure in Private/Public Cloud using OpenStack. Non-Technical Requirements: Agile software development practices. Work with geographically distributed teams. Understand IT processes, including Design, implementation, and Operations.
